Evaluating Resource Utilization Rates

Once key impact areas are recognized, the next step includes calculating usage levels to assess the company's ecological impact. This process requires a systematic approach to collect information on power, liquid, and material consumption across all activities. Employing tools such as power assessments, liquid evaluations, and material tracking analysis can provide insights into consumption patterns. Organizations should also consider establishing benchmarks to compare against sector benchmarks or previous results. By analyzing these measurements, businesses can pinpoint inefficiencies and opportunities for reduction. Accurate measurement not only helps in adherence with ecological laws but also enhances company environmental initiatives. This data-driven approach is essential for choosing wisely that support lasting ecological objectives.

What Cost Range Should Businesses Anticipate for Environmental Consulting?

Consulting expenses for environmental work provided to businesses usually range between $100 to $300 per hour, determined by the firm's knowledge and complexity. Set pricing for projects can also be offered, changing according to the specific requirements and length.

Which Certifications Should I Seek out in an Eco-Consultant?

When identifying an environmental consultant, you should search for qualifications such as Certified Environmental Professional (CEP), ISO 14001, or LEED accreditation, as these show expertise and dedication to green operations within environmental management.
